I actually did get introduced to D&D at band camp, I was a high school freshman in 1980 and some of the seniors had their AD&D 1e books with them. I started flipping through the Monster Manual, understanding almost nothing (how many Demogorgons can you fight at once?) and started making a little store called Conflicts in Allentown, PA my second home. Once I found a few other guys my own age to play we started to get together on a regular basis. One of the first adventures we ran through was the old Judges Guild module Dark Tower. AWESOME fun, I still remember the cleric I was running managed to smash the lich in the top of Set's tower (Pnessut?) with a mace of disruption, the DM rolled his save in the open and needed a 6 or better, but got a 5. The crowd went wild. Been playing pretty steadily since then with various groups, the latest going on four years of various campaigns. We usually play out a storyline until we're moderate to high level (12-17) and then start again with someone new in the DM seat. I know that it's considered, mmm, let's say "unfashionable", in some circles, but I really couldn't care less and intend to keep playing as long as I can roll a die and can find fellow gamers.
